When does rebuilding an earth mover beat replacing it?

When the frame and structures are sound and the machine still fits the operation, a frame-up rebuild resets major components and the cost curve without new-machine capital or lead time. The rebuild program page covers scope and process.

What is line boring and when does a machine need it?

Line boring restores worn or damaged bores, like pin bosses on loader arms and excavator sticks, to spec without replacing the structure. It is the fix when pins hammer loose in oversized bores. Bulk performs certified welding and line boring in the shop and in the field.
